Connect the desoldering iron to an outlet and allow the heating element to heat up.
Allow the iron to preheat for 3-5 minutes, then push down the piston rod.
Cover component pin with nozzle, melt solder, and press button to extract solder.
Disconnect the power cord when the operation is complete.
Important notes on melting solder, handling remaining solder, stuck components, and cleaning.
How to clean nozzle oxidization using metal wool and solder.
Do not use metal files for cleaning; replace if deformed or rusted.
Avoid excessive force on the nozzle to prevent damage.
Clean and tin the nozzle after each operation to prevent oxidization.
Heat element, use cleaning pin to clean nozzle inner hole.
Clean heating element after removing nozzle and tin storage tube.
Turn off power, wait for cooling, then clean the storage tube.
Indicator ON but no heat indicates a faulty heating element requiring replacement.

| Model | YIHUA 929D5 |
|---|---|
| Category | Power Tool |
| Temperature Stability | ±1°C |
| Tip to Ground Resistance | < 2Ω |
| Display | LCD |
| Temperature Range | 100-480°C |
| Input Voltage | AC 220V |
| Voltage | 220V |
| Tip to Ground Voltage | < 2mV |
| Heating Time | 30 seconds |
| Hot Air Gun Nozzle | Several nozzles included |
